## Escalation: Mistral-gate circuit breaker (upstream Ledgerly API)

If the breaker for the Ledgerly upstream stays open past three consecutive half-open probes, do not force-close it manually; this has previously caused retry storms. Instead, confirm upstream health via the Ledgerly status dashboard, capture the breaker state snapshot, and page the Integrations on-call. For review questions about threshold tuning, contact the owning team at the address below.

alerts address for bagaf-fajog: oliwyn@norvasys.internal

Ticket TT-418: Chronoplan timetable solver drops double-period labs when a teacher has split-campus availability. Repro: 1) Load the Fernvale Academy sample dataset. 2) Mark instructor "M. Quarrel" available mornings-only at North campus. 3) Run the solver with the default constraint weights. 4) Observe the chemistry double block vanishes from Wednesday instead of relocating. Expected: solver relocates or flags an infeasibility. For the weekly sync, please re-run against the staging solver; it requires the bearer token below.

session JWT of yawep-yawep = eyJhbGciOiJIUzI1NiIsInR5cCI6IkpXVCJ9.eyJzdWIiOiI3pWF3_In0.aXYsHiog

## Action Item: Zero-downtime migration guardrails

Owner: platform team. Due: next sprint.

The Bramblewick outage traced to a long-running column backfill locking the ledger table. Going forward, all schema migrations must run through the phased migrator with enforced batch sizes and lock timeouts. No manual ALTERs in prod. Guardrail config ships as defaults in the migrator; overrides require review. Enforced constants follow.

tuning constants:
QUOTAS = {
    "druwyn": 5,
    "holix": 5,
    "zorath": 5,
    "holwyn": 10,
}

UserSplit Cutover Drift: the extracted account service and the legacy Marigold monolith user module are reporting divergent record counts during dual-write. This fires when drift exceeds 0.5% over 15 minutes. New team members should not replay writes manually. Reconciliation steps and the rollback procedure are documented on the internal page.

wiki page, tajog-fafog: https://gitlab.paliqsys.corp/dash/display/job/853dd6fcbf54